The concepts of pink noise and white noise commonly emerge in discussions about sleep high quality. Both are kinds of audio wave patterns that are generally utilized to assist sleep, each having special features and results. White noise is a constant noise that covers a vast array of frequencies, much like the static noise from a television or radio. It can mask history sounds, which can be helpful for people who live in environments with constant disruptions. On the other hand, pink noise, while additionally a constant sound, has an extra well balanced set of regularities that reduce in intensity as the frequency increases. This can develop a much more soothing acoustic experience, frequently compared to the mild sound of rainfall or wind. Some studies also suggest that pink noise might lead to better sleep quality by cultivating deeper sleep phases, which can be specifically appealing for those attempting to enhance their every night remainder.

In discussions of sleep cycles, the 90-minute sleep cycle is a pivotal principle for sleep lovers and those seeking a better understanding of their remainder patterns. Human sleep traditionally progresses with numerous phases throughout the night, and one full cycle normally lasts around 90 minutes. Within this cycle, people move via light sleep, deep sleep, and REM sleep. Understanding this cyclical nature makes it possible for individuals to time their sleep successfully, enhancing how they feel upon waking. The vital to waking up freshened usually lies in lining up wake-up moments with completion of these sleep cycles. Therefore, people intending to wake up feeling renewed should consider timing their sleep or naps in 90-minute increments.
